Abstract

"PELìCULAS BIAXIALMENTE ORIENTADAS DE BAIXO BRILHO COMPREENDENDO POLìMEROS AROMáTICOS DE VINILA E PARTìCULAS DE BORRACHA SUBSTANCIALMENTE NãO ESFéRICAS". A presente invenção refere-se a uma película polimérica biaxialmente orientada de baixo brilho contendo um pol aromático de vinila e partículas de borracha substancialmente não esféricas útil para aplicações como películas para janelas. As partículas de borracha, quando não-constritas, são essencialmente esféricas e têm um tamanho de partícula de 2,5 micrometros ou mais.
